Alignment Cards
Meetings can easily drift into endless discussions, unclear decisions, and silent disagreement. The Alignment Cards help you make those invisible dynamics visible.
Each person gets three cards: green for “I agree,” white for “I’m okay, but…,” and red for “I disagree.” At key moments, everyone raises their card — creating an instant visual pulse of alignment in the room.
It’s a simple, honest, and surprisingly powerful tool to surface hesitation early and prevent false consensus. Use it to make decisions transparent, voices visible, and meetings truly collaborative.

World Map Sequence
Big goals can feel overwhelming when you don’t know where to start. The World Map Sequence helps you navigate your path with clarity and momentum.
It begins with the World Map, where you mark where you are now and where you want to be — not just in goals, but in how it feels. Next comes the Speedboat, to uncover the anchors holding you back. Finally, the Space Rocket helps you design how to overcome those obstacles and launch forward.
Together, these three tools turn reflection into direction — a creative journey from where you stand to where you truly want to go.
